These speakers, and others with the same parts, have been made by Polk for probably 10 or more years now. This set is from 2013, and is still being made. They are good in my opinion, about what you’d expect for their price.

Will they play good sideways like Bose 201s are made
@djijspeakerguy4628
@djijspeakerguy4628 2 жыл бұрын
These will actually sound their best mounted higher up on a wall with their stock keyhole slots due to how the sound waves from the components line up: listening to these straight on will cause a gap in the lower treble: they would sound thin and hissy in the top end. I actually switched the polarity of the tweeter (treble speaker) inside one of my t15s and it sounded better at ear level than the stock one.

There are way better speakers than this for the price. However, they are very common, and I think I know why. They are louder at a lower volume level compared to their competitors, which makes them sound “fuller” in the demos. However, if you switch to another speaker and turn the volume up, it will likely sound better.
